keywords: genome sequence, 16S sequence, Bacteria, aerobe, mesophilic, Gram-negative, rod-shaped
description: Aquimarina spongiae A6 is an aerobe, mesophilic, Gram-negative bacterium that was isolated from marine sponge, Halichondria oshoro.
